Output 7a2313cbac07b8f45496f283bb66a4be5d4e56d059a594d83174e10d7a8d7942:12

value
904790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e3b512a883fc58272092760bf022c8b3f338fa OP_EQUAL
address
39FJ7eyT3gWSMuf3ajDmzKbCjPDS9Sutr7
transaction
7a2313cbac07b8f45496f283bb66a4be5d4e56d059a594d83174e10d7a8d7942
confirmations
181886
spent
true